
Siobhán Walsh
Siobhán Walsh is the Chief Executive of Goal, an Irish humanitarian aid agency that provides assistance in crisis-affected regions worldwide. Under her leadership, Goal has received significant funding from USAid, making it one of the largest recipients of US foreign assistance in the humanitarian sector. In light of a recent funding freeze imposed by the Trump administration, Walsh emphasized the critical role that institutional donors play in scaling life-saving responses to humanitarian crises. She has been vocal about the agency's efforts to secure waivers that allow continued operations in impacted areas, such as Syria, where Goal delivers essential services to millions of people in need.
